About Solveig Hasselwander

Solveig Hasselwander is a scholar working on Internal Medicine, Geriatrics and Gerontology, Neurology, Biochemistry and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 10 papers that have together received 490 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neurological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(2 papers), Cardiovascular Disease and Adiposity (2 papers), Peroxisome Proliferator-Activated Receptors (2 papers),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(2 papers), Sodium Intake and Health (1 paper), Cardiovascular, Neuropeptides, and Oxidative Stress Research (1 paper), Adipokines, Inflammation, and Metabolic Diseases (1 paper) and Heme Oxygenase-1 and Carbon Monoxide (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Geriatrics and Gerontology (55 citations), Biochemistry (38 citations), Physiology (115 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(25 citations) and Cancer Research (51 citations). Solveig Hasselwander has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Huige Li, Ning Xia, Andreas Daiber, Philipp A. Lang, Nina Seiwert, Jörg Fahrer, Daniel Heylmann, Thomas Brunner, Tanja Schwerdtle and Gisela Reifenberg.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Functional Foods, Scientific Reports, Cell Death and Disease, Biomedicines and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
